Dipyridamole has been prescribed for the client who underwent a valve replacement, and the nurse has provided teaching to the client about the medication. Which statement indicates that the client understands the medication instructions?

  • A. This medication will prevent a stroke.
  • B. This medication will prevent a heart attack.
  • C. This medicine will protect my artificial heart valve.
  • D. This medication will help me keep my blood pressure down.
Correct Answer: C

Rationale: Dipyridamole is an antiplatelet medication. It may be administered in combination with warfarin sodium to protect the client's artificial heart valves. Dipyridamole does not prevent stroke or heart attacks. It is an antiplatelet medication rather than an antihypertensive.
